Planning 5 days/4 nights out of McGee Creek this July. As for our experience - level 3, class 2/3, prefer 6-8 mile days (but capable of 10-12 if necessary).

In trying to determine our itinerary, the Scheelore Mine keeps coming to our attention. I have found relatively little information online about the mine and whether or not it is a worthy side trip.
We plan to spend a day hiking Red Slate Mountain from McGee Pass, and would consider venturing over the pass to Tully Lake or others. I'm really just looking for any information on Scheelore Mine, if there is much to see and explore there, and if it may be a worthy side trip. It's a nice hike up to the Sheelore Mine on a very old road, for the hike itself. The mine, as I recall it, is little more then some timbers and an adit
